UNCERTAIN GERMANIC TRIBES, Pseudo-Imperial coinage. Late 3rd-early 4th centuries. 'Aureus' (Gold, 21 mm, 3.74 g, 12 h), 'Derived Gordian Group B'. KOCTS K ΛMS CK Laureate and draped imperial bust to right, seen from behind. Rev. KTSO Γ SNO Mars advancing right, holding spear in his right hand and shield in his left. CNG 90 (2012), 1982 ( same dies ). A beautiful piece struck on a very broad flan. Original suspension loop broken off and holed instead, otherwise, nearly extremely fine.
From the Aurum Barbarorum Collection.
